Output c26a9336258f872c3d8d4fc6bc00afa28b83c9a43275877115ae5b189d3432f9:0

value
15617189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ef9c56127f31a0323c7ac5c7ef29e26e78fe6c80 OP_EQUAL
address
3PXxhpe9HwU7ehqpC1S7yiRUq1MEveiigr
transaction
c26a9336258f872c3d8d4fc6bc00afa28b83c9a43275877115ae5b189d3432f9
spent
true